The service currently takes holiday-goers from London to places like France, the Netherlands and Belgium.

But a brand new route could take travellers to these big European cities straight from Scotland without having to go to England first.

Midnight Trains, a French train company, has confirmed that they have plans to launch a new route from Paris to Milan as well as Venice.

They also announced that they plan to launch new routes from Edinburgh.

Not only would this connect the Scots capital to Paris, but it would also connect to Copenhagen and Berlin.

This means that Scots can jump a train to Paris and then change trains to go to either of the destinations.

And it won’t even take any time away from your day, as the service includes sleeper trains.

The state-of-the-art trains have been described as “hotels on wheels,” and even come with their own private rooms complete with private showers.

Travellers can choose between single, double or even four-bed rooms when they book up.

There is also table service and drinks from the cocktail bar – and the rooms even have on-demand films.

Speaking to the National, co-founder Romain Payet said: “We think that travellers are more and more conscious about the ecological impact of air travel and they need an alternative.

“But when travelling to and from most major European cities, they do not have this alternative.”

There is no official date for the launch of the new trains, however, they are expected to come sometime next year.
